Jenny in Ohio said...

I think it's a cool store, but not a place I do my regular shopping because it doesn't have everything. However, what it does have is good! They do have a lot of frozen pre-prepared stuff, which can be good, but if you like to eat fresher things, not so much. I think the cheese selection is awesome, and I love their tortilla chips. I find their prices to be normal to cheaper than a regular grocery. Also, if they have it, you MUST get Cookie Butter!-

Donna said...

I just love Trader Joe's! Here are a few of my favorites: butternut squash soup (comes in a carton), their chicken salad, their vanilla yogurt with almond chips, from the frozen section their mushroom ravioli, orange chicken, sweet potato gnoochi, and veggie burgers (add salsa to 'em). Also love their apple breakfast bars (like a nutri grain bar only better), and they also make this flatbread thing in the frozen section with ham and carmelized onions. It's awesome!

brianne said...

ooh my gosh, I could go on and on. I agree with Jenny who said you can't really do it for all your shopping, but you can do a lot. They have a great selection of premade salads and wraps - the chicken pesto wrap is super good. We also get their champagne vinegrette, chocolate and seasalt covered almonds, frozen veggie gyoza dumplings. Their frozen french onion soup is pretty decent for a quick french onion fix.
